Climate campaigner Al Gore has cancelled a lecture he was supposed to deliver here.
The former US vice president and Nobel Peace Prize winner had been scheduled to speak to more than 3,000 people at a December 16 event hosted by the Berlingske Tidende newspaper group.
The group says Mr. Gore cancelled the lecture on Thursday, citing unforeseen changes in his schedule.
Mr. Gore spokeswoman Kalee Kreider says the decision was made because of “all the events going on with the summit“.
December 16 is a key date for the meeting because that’s when the ministerial segment starts.
Chief editor Lisbeth Knudsen says it’s a “great disappointment” that Mr. Gore cancelled and that all tickets will be refunded.
